Epoch Details
Epoch Number
265492
Finalized
Yes
Age
703 days 15 hrs ago (Feb-24-2024 11:09:11 AM +UTC)
Blocks
Attestations
3072
Participation Rate
99.75%
Voted Ether
30,685,530 ETH
Eligible Ether
30,763,152 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
1240775
Active Count
1239616
Pending Count
1159